Westbrook is Back!!

Eagles running back Brian Westbrook is back.

He picked up over 200 yards total from scrimmage on Sunday in the Eagles important 27-14 win over the visiting Atlanta Falcons, leading them to victory.

Westbrook did it all. He ran the football, he caught the football and then ran with it and when needed he blocked oncoming defenders to give quarterback Donovan McNabb more time to find an open receiver down field.

Westbrook was having a tiny bit of trouble getting healthy earlier in the season and missed a couple of games due to ankle and rib problems but seems to be back on track and in the fold.

He posted a career high for rushing yards in one game with 167 en route to the win.

If Westbrook can remain healthy for the rest of the season along with McNabb and Curtis, then the Birds have a decent shot at making a move in the crowded NFC East.
